PROGRAM LOCATIONS LEFT RIGHT COIN DENOMINATION Enter Left Right Coin Denomination 0 05 to 25 00 The left and right coin acceptors can be independently set to a value within the range of 0 05 to 25 00 adjustable in 0 01 increments PL10 PROGRAM LOCATION Enter Time for Amount to Start 1 to 99 minutes This location determines the time that is vended once the amount to start is met This 15 programmable from 1 minute to 99 minutes in 1 minute increments PL11 PROGRAM LOCATION Amount to Start This location determines the amount needed to start a dry cycle The amount to start 15 programmable from minimum of 0 05 to a maximum of 25 00 adjustable in 0 01 increments 15 12 PROGRAM LOCATION Enter Amount for Additional Time This location determines the amount needed to add more time to a dry cycle The amount for additional time 15 programmable from a minimum of 0 05 to a maximum of 25 00 adjustable in 0 01 increments PL13 PROGRAM LOCATION Enter Prepurge Time to 25 seconds When the Phase 7 controller detects the need for heat it will wait for this prepurge time to expire before actually sending the signal for the heat to turn on Enter DSI Purge Time 0 to 25 seconds After the controller sends the heat signal the controller will wait for the Direct Spark Ignition DSI purge time to expire before it checks to see if the gas valve return signal is present Enter DSI Proof Time 0 to 20 seconds After the c

ROTATIONAL SENSOR FAULT This routine monitors the pulses from the rotational sensor input It basically times the dwell between the signals If the time between the pulses exceeds 8 seconds the controller will trigger a Rotate Sensor Fault condition The dryer will run with no heat for 2 minutes or until the temperature drops below 100 F 38 C If the basket tumbler temperature 15 below 100 F 38 C the controller will shut off ALL outputs and will go into a fault mode with a brief audio indication EXHAUST HIGH TEMP FAULT This error routine indicates a problem with overheating This error will initiate an Exhaust High Temp Fault condition The controller determines this error by monitoring the temperature sensor input to have a steady gradual increase in temperature to a known upper limit the limit typically 1s 20 over the maximum allowed programmable set point The controller will disengage ALL outputs and will go into a fault mode with a brief audio indication 59 B SENSOR ACTIVATED FIRE EXTINGUISHING SYSTEM DIAGNOSTIC MESSAGES OPEN S A F E SYSTEM TEMPERATURE PROBE FAULT This message indicates that the S A F E system probe 15 either not connected or 15 damaged SHORTED 5 TEMPERATURE PROBE FAULT This indicates that the S A F E system temperature probe is shorted or the wire to the S A F E system temperature probe is shorted S A F E SYSTEM ACTIVATED OR S A F E SYSTEM

Ifthe basket tumbler temperature is above 100 38 C the dryer will continue to display Burner Ignition Control Fault while the dryer cools by running with no heat for 2 minutes or until the temperature drops below 100 38 C Once the basket tumbler temperature is below 100 F 38 C the controller will shut off ALL outputs and will go into a fault mode with a brief audio indication IGNITION FAULT After the controller receives a gas valve return signal within the DSI purge time the controller will begin a DSI prooftime The controller will continue to recheck the gas valve return signal if signal is lost during the DSI proof time the controller will turn off the heat output and will determine what the retry count in PL 14 is set at If the retry count is greater than zero the controller will wait 20 seconds and will attempt to reignite the flame If the failure condition occurs again the controller will retry until the retry count in PL14 has been satisfied Once the retry count has been satisfied the controller will interrupt the cycle and will display Ignition Fault condition If the basket tumbler temperature 15 above 100 F 38 C the controller will continue to display Ignition Fault while the dryer cools by running with no heat for 2 minutes or until the temperature drops below 100 38 C Once the basket tumbler temperature 15 below 100 F 38 C the controller will shut off ALL outputs and will go

Once the lint count 15 reached the lint drawer must be opened for at least 3 seconds in order to reset the counter If the lint drawer 15 not cleaned within 2 hours the dryer pocket will be locked out CHECK MAIN FUSE This routine identifies the opening of the main fuse fuse 2 on the phase 7 control board If the fuse has opened the microprocessor will not allow cycle to begin and will display Check Main Fuse condition If coins are entered the credit will be accumulated as it should however it will not be applicable to a cycle until the error has been corrected If the fuse has opened after the cycle has begun it will still trigger the check main fuse fault The dryer will run with no heat for 2 minutes or until the basket tumbler temperature drops below 100 38 C If the basket tumbler temperature 15 below 100 38 C the controller will shut off ALL outputs and will go into a fault mode with a brief audio indication EXHAUST TEMPERATURE SENSOR FAULT AXIAL TEMPERATURE SENSOR FAULT This routine indicates a problem with the temperature sensor circuit This error will trigger an Exhaust Probe Fault or Axial Probe Fault condition The dryer will run with no heat for 2 minutes or until the basket tumbler temperature drops below 100 F 38 C If the basket tumbler temperature is below 100 F 38 C the controller will shut off ALL outputs and will go into a fault mode with a brief audio indication

Limit Fault The controller will check the basket tumbler temperature If the exhaust probe temperature is above 100 F 38 C the dryer will continue to display Burner High Limit Fault while the dryer cools by running with no heat for 2 minutes or until the temperature drops below 100 F 38 C If the exhaust probe temperature is below 100 F 38 C the controller will shut off ALL outputs and will go into a fault mode with a brief audio indication EXHAUST HIGH LIMIT FAULT This routine monitors the basket tumbler safety over temperature switch Ifthe switch opens the dryer will display Exhaust High Limit Fault Ifthe basket tumbler temperature is above 100 38 C the dryer will continue to display Exhaust High Limit Fault while the controller cools by running with no heat for 2 minutes or until the temperature drops below 100 F 38 C If the basket tumbler temperature 1s below 100 F 38 C the controller will shut off ALL outputs and will go into a fault mode with a brief audio indication BURNER IGNITION CONTROL This routine monitors the ignition control and gas valve return signal in comparison to the Direct Spark Ignition DSI purge time set in PL13 If gas valve return signal from the ignition control has not turned on or has disengaged prior to the expiration of the DSI purge time set in PL13 the controller will interrupt the cycle and will display Burner Ignition Control Fault condition

29. into a fault mode with a brief audio indication FLAME FAULT After the controller has verified that the gas valve signal was present through out the DSI purge time and the DSI proof time the controller will continue to monitor the gas valve return signal In the event that the gas valve return signal is lost anytime after the DSI proof time the controller will turn off heat output and will increment a counter Once this fault condition occurs 5 consecutive times the controller will interrupt the cycle and will display Flame Fault condition If the basket tumbler temperature 15 above 100 38 C controller will continue to display Flame Fault while the dryer cools by running with no heat for 2 minutes or until the temperature drops below 100 F 38 C Once the basket tumbler temperature 15 below 100 F 38 C the controller will shut off ALL outputs and will go into a fault mode with a brief audio indication 58 CLEAN LINT This routine monitors the opening of the lint drawer switch to each pocket and compares the time between openings to the lint cleaning frequency set in PL14 This routine will first prompt the user to clean lint before locking out the dryer pocket Once the time between cleanings is equal to the setting in PL14 the display will prompt the user to clean lint The lint cleaning frequency limits the amount of time the dryer will run before the microprocessor locks the dryer out for further use
30. program keeps items wrinkle free when they are not removed from the dryer promptly at the end of the drying cycle and or cooling cycle When the drying and cooling cycle 15 completed the dryer will shut off the tone will sound and the liquid crystal display L C D will read ANTI WRINKLE If the door is not opened the phase 7 dual coin microprocessor controller computer will wait until the Anti Wrinkle Delay Time of 2 minutes has expired at which time the fan will start and the basket tumbler will rotate without heat for the Anti Wrinkle On Time of 2 minutes The phase 7 dual coin microprocessor controller computer will repeat this process until the Maximum Anti Wrinkle Time of 99 minutes has expired or until the door 1s opened whichever comes first Prior to each ON time there is a 3 beep warning that the fan and basket tumbler rotation 15 about to start The beeps at the end of the Anti Wrinkle Cycle can be programmed to be ON OFF refer to page 10 PL01 Select Buzzer Mode NOTE Thefollowing information description 1s an explanation of the Sensor Activated Fire Extinguishing S A F E system functionality This feature is programmed at the factory and effects dryers that are equipped with the S A F E S A F E System While the dryer 15 in an idle state or 20 seconds after the heat turns off the phase 7 dual coin microprocessor controller seperately monitors the S A F E system temperature probe located in the bac

46. k of each basket tumbler chamber and records the minimum temperature If the minimum recorded 5 system probe temperature is greater than 120 F 48 C and the controller detects a 50 rise in temperature this will be the trip point and the S A F E system routine will activate While a drying cycle 15 in process and the heat has turned on at least once the phase 7 dual coin microprocessor controller seperately monitors the exhaust temperature transducer for each pocket If drying cycle temperature set point 1s set greater than 160 F 71 C and the controller detects an exhaust temperature rise 25 F greater than set point this will be the trip point and the S A F E system routine will activate If set point is below 1609 F 71 C the trip point will be 185 F 85 C Once the S A F E system routine is activated the display will read S A F E System activated and water will be injected into both basket tumbler chambers Anytime water 1s being injected into the baskets tumblers on the pocket that detected the fire the baskets tumblers drive will turn the load for 1 second every 15 seconds This process will continue for a minimum of 2 minutes After 2 minutes has elapsed the controller will check if the temperature remained above trip point 1f so water will remain on The controller will continue to check if temperature is above trip point every 30 seconds Ifthe water has been on for a constant 10 minut

48. lint access must be opened for 5 seconds or more for the reset to occur Enter Retry Count 0 to 2 This count is used to determine how many ignition attempts are allowed if an ignition attempt 1s unsuccessful This counter increments when the heat output engages and the valve signal 15 lost after the trial for ignition period expires This counter also will automatically reset once an ignition attempt 15 successful The retry count range is from 0 to 2 16 Upper Dryer Faults Whenever fault occurs with the upper dryer pocket the phase 7 dual coin microprocessor controller will store the fault description in this location The phase 7 dual coin microprocessor controller will also store the hour logger time and the temperature cycle that was the pocket was in at the time of fault The controller will stores the last five fault that occurred every time a new fault occurs the oldest fault will be erased and the new fault will be stored Lower Dryer Faults Whenever a fault occurs with the lower dryer pocket the phase 7 dual coin microprocessor controller will store the fault description in this location The phase 7 dual coin microprocessor controller will also store the hour logger time and the temperature cycle that was the pocket was in at the time of fault The controller will stores the last five faults that occurred every time a new fault occurs the oldest fault will be erased and the new fault will be stored ANTI WRINKLE This

51. ontroller receives a gas valve signal within the DSI purge time the controller will begin a DSI proof timer After the DSI proof time has expired the controller will recheck for the gas signal Enter Buzz Time 1 to 9 beeps If buzzer mode is set to ON this location determines how many times the buzzer will beep at the end of an Anti Wrinkle cycle Enter Pause Time 0 to 3 minutes Ifthe pause button is pressed and the main door 15 open the controller will wait for the pause time defined in this setting to expire Once the time has expired the controller will begin to count down the dry time If the pause button is not pressed prior to opening the door the controller will not wait for the pause time before counting down the dry time PL14 PROGRAM LOCATION Enter Lint Cleaning Frequency 0 to 10 hours This feature monitors the hours of drying time for each pocket and compares it with the Lint Cleaning Frequency setting in PL14 Once the lint cleaning frequency time has been met the controller will begin prompting the user to clean the lint drawer The controller will allow two 2 more hours of drying time before locking out the dryer pocket The controller will not respond until after the lint drawer has been cleaned out When the lint drawer 15 opened the display will read LINT ACCESS OPEN and when the lint drawer is closed the controller will go back to a ready state and will read READY INSERT 258 TO START NOTE The

56. s HIGH MEDIUM and LOW each programmable to a drying temperature between 100 F 38 C and 190 F 87 C for radial airflow or 100 F 38 C and 150 F 66 C for axial airflow E Cool Down Cool down lowers the temperature in the basket tumbler to make the material cool enough to handle F Liquid Crvstal Display L C D The phase 7 dual coin microprocessor controller features a 128 x 64 dots graphic liquid crystal display that has been subdivided into two 2 sections one 1 section for the top dryer pocket and one 1 section for the bottom dryer pocket The phase 7 dual coin microprocessor controller informs users of cycle status programs settings and displays important diagnostic and fault codes via the liquid crystal display G Anti Wrinkle Program Helps keep items wrinkle free when they are not removed from the dryer promptly at the end ofthe drying and cooling cycles H Diagnostics The phase 7 dual coin microprocessor controller monitors major circuits including door switches temperature sensors heat output circuits and more for each dryer pocket individually This allows for precise failure messages I Audio Alert Signal The tone will sound at the end of a complete drying cycle at a 1 second rate for the duration programmed It will also sound for any fault conditions at a quarter second rate for 4 beeps Finally there 15 a 3 beep warning at the beginning of every Anti Wrinkle On Cycle and

58. the startup of the dryer unless the sail switch 15 in the open position If the sail switch is in the closed position prior to starting the controller will display Out of Order for a Sail Switch Closed Fault and the dryer will not be allowed to start This routine 15 also monitored at every startup including during the cycle Anytime the fault occurs there will be an audio indication and start restart will be prevented 57 SAIL SWITCH OPEN FAULT If the sail switch does close within 8 seconds of starting restarting a cycle the controller will display Sail Switch Open Fault condition Or ifthe sail switch opens during a cycle controller will immediately shut off the heat output and will monitor how long the sail switch is open for if the sail switch is open for more than 30 seconds the controller will display Sail Switch Open Fault condition If the basket tumbler temperature is above 100 F 38 C the controller will continue to display Sail Switch Fault while the dryer cools by running with no heat for 2 minutes or until the temperature drops below 100 F 38 C Once the basket tumbler temperature 1s below 100 F 38 C the controller will shut off ALL outputs and will go into a fault mode with a brief audio indication BURNER HIGH LIMIT FAULT This routine monitors the burner high limit switch If the switch opens during the cycle while the heat is on the dryer will display Burner High
